Famous Patients
Famous patients with MDS include:
- astronomer Carl Sagan
- Nobel Chemistry Prize winner Alan MacDiarmid
- writers Susan Sontag and Nora Ephron
- writer Roald Dahl
- jazz musicians Michael Brecker and Paul Motian
- actress Nina Foch
- firearms executive Val Forgett
- United States Congressmen Joe Moakley and Bob Matsui
- actor Pat Hingle
- singer and comedienne Fran Allison
- radio personality J.P. McCarthy
- Danish theoretical physicist Per Bak
- first National Spelling Bee winner Frank Neuhauser
- plant pathologist Jack Bailey
- Good Morning America host Robin Roberts
- General Motor employee and Navy veteran John T. Geis Jr.
